Job description

GENERAL SUMMARY

The Steak House Host provides a warm greeting for guest, circulate the room while seating guests and accommodate the initial interaction between guest and the service team. The Steak House Host should permeate a welcoming persona to each guest walking by or into the restaurant. Their purpose is to start the dining experience from the moment the guest arrives. The Steak House Host is the first and last impression of the venue to guests. The Steak House Host controls the pace at which a restaurant fills and can affect the fluidity of an entire shift and is responsible for correctly handling cash, credit, and comp procedures, as well as, properly completing paperwork and providing guest service.
